Could this be him? (remember a late November 1940 death could have registered in Jan./Mar.1941 quarter)
Convery Michael of Heysham Harbour Heysham county Lancashire England farmer and timekeeper died 30 November 1940 Administration Belfast 30 March to Patrick J. Convery farmer. Effects £258 15s.
I can't see a birth in 1883 in Magherafelt registration district (which covers Maghera). There is an 1882 birth in the area (Fallagloon townland, Maghera sub-district)- https://civilrecords.irishgenealogy.ie/churchrecords/images/birth_returns/births_1882/02798/2027022.pdf
Same family?

Suspect it refers to this Michael. Heysham came under the Lancaster RD
Deaths December qtr 1940
Convery Michael 62 Lancaster 8e 1535
-
No 1939 entry for him. If he only came to England temporarily it could be his death in 1940 but that Michael was born around 1878 not 1883.
Ages on a death cert can vary and are very much dependant on who reported the death and how well they knew the deceased
